Long Sault Parkway - A local birder alerted me to this bird today. He thought it was a Red-necked but it has Red Phalarope features including overall whitish appearance with gray back and bill that is thicker at the base and paler than the rest of the bill. A rare regional find. Note the lobed toes. That's why phalaropes can swim unlike other shorebirds.

Cornwall - It was a juvenile (yellow eye) and I determined it was a male based on smaller size and shorter tail but clearly a Cooper's and not a Sharpie with that rounded tail.
